[1913 Webster] From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]: Bonny \Bon"ny\ (-n[y^]), a. [Spelled {bonnie} by the Scotch.] [OE. boni, prob. fr. F. bon, fem. bonne, good, fr. L. bonus good. See {Bounty}, and cf. {Bonus}, {Boon}.] 1. Handsome; beautiful; pretty; attractively lively and graceful. [1913 Webster] Till bonny Susan sped across the plain. --Gay. [1913 Webster] Far from the bonnie banks of Ayr. --Burns. [1913 Webster] 2. Gay; merry; frolicsome; cheerful; blithe. [1913 Webster] Be you blithe and bonny. --Shak. [1913 Webster] Report speaks you a bonny monk, that would hear the matin chime ere he quitted his bowl. --Sir W. Scott.
